Beautifully maintained and thoughtfully updated, this single-story home sits on a spacious 0.287-acre lot in the highly desirable Oakwood Estates—just minutes to Loop 337, HEB, restaurants, shopping, and everyday essentials. With an updated HVAC system and numerous improvements, the home blends comfort, function, and modern style in an established neighborhood with no HOA and a low tax rate. A circular and extended driveway plus a 2-car garage create abundant parking and a welcoming first impression. The property offers a perfect balance of usable space: a large grassy side yard for play and pets, plus xeriscaped areas with custom concrete features, a rock riverbed, and a French drain system for low-maintenance living. Extended fencing enhances privacy and maximizes the yard. Inside, the open-concept layout features a bright living room with a vaulted ceiling, skylight, and cozy fireplace. Plank wood-faux flooring runs throughout—no carpet anywhere—creating a clean, cohesive look. The eat-in kitchen includes granite countertops, abundant cabinetry, a gas range, and upgraded Bosch appliances. A flex room off the living area works beautifully as a playroom, office, or hobby space, while the formal dining room is ideal for gatherings. The primary suite offers patio access, a walk-in closet, and an updated en-suite bath with a granite dual vanity and walk-in shower. Outdoor living impresses with an expansive covered patio featuring a tongue-and-groove ceiling and a built-in wet bar with sink and beverage refrigerator. The large fenced backyard is perfect for entertaining, relaxing, or gardening. And throughout Oakwood Estates, golf-cart living is a popular and convenient part of the lifestyle.
